testwest Posted December 14, 2014 Report Share Posted December 14, 2014 I just recently visited Paul Loewen and the gang at LASAR in Lakeport, California. They bought all of Dennis Bernhard's (Lone Star Aero) parts stock, which he in turn got from Mooney when they stopped building the mid-bodies. Paul said they have a brand new (NOS) J cowl in the inventory. May want to check with them.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
